Output 9663e3758d3bfff95ae58818a3a54b173bcd6d606710237dd8f0c91c9e27385c:1

value
6517046
script pubkey
OP_0 OP_PUSHBYTES_20 deef4da5575d07016ed43f13db207996e011b8eb
address
bc1qmmh5mf2ht5rszmk58ufakgrejmsprw8tmc95mt
transaction
9663e3758d3bfff95ae58818a3a54b173bcd6d606710237dd8f0c91c9e27385c
spent
true